How might climate change contribute to a food shortage?

Respuesta :

jaelenlewis96 jaelenlewis96
  • 08-04-2021
Climate change affects food production and availability, access, quality, utilization, and stability of food systems. In short, it impacts all aspects of the food system. Extreme weather related disasters are increasing and reduce the yields of major crops. Higher levels of CO2 reduce the nutritional value of crops.
